| Error Message | Likely Cause | Fix | |--------------|--------------|-----| | “Communication with radio failed” | Wrong COM port or cable driver | Reinstall Prolific/FTDI driver; try COM1–COM4 | | “Codeplug too new for this application” | CPS version older than radio’s firmware | Update CPS to a newer build | | “Checksum error” | Corrupted read/write | Retry; if persistent, codeplug may be corrupt – requires factory alignment | | “Radio not responding” | Cable not fully seated or radio OFF | Reseat D-sub connector; turn radio ON |

Motorola GM338 Go to product viewer dialog for this item. is part of the Waris series of mobile radios. Programming it requires the "Professional Radio CPS" (Customer Programming Software) rather than the newer MOTOTRBO 2.0 software. 🛠️ Hardware Requirements
Programming Cable: You need a DB9-to-RJ45 or USB-to-RJ45 cable. Cables like the Serial Port RS-232 Programming Cable Go to product viewer dialog for this item.
or USB Programming Cable available on eBay are common choices.
PC Environment: While modern versions of the software can run on newer Windows versions, older versions of the Professional Radio CPS often perform best on Windows XP or Windows 7. 💻 Software Download Guide
Motorola typically restricts software access to authorized partners and business account holders.
Official Access: Log into the Motorola Solutions Partner Hub or Customer Hub.
Search Terms: Look for "Professional Radio CPS" or "GM338 CPS".
Third-Party Sources: Be cautious with "repack" or "exclusive" downloads found on forums or unofficial sites like RadioSoftware.online, as they often require paid memberships or carry malware risks. 📝 Basic Programming Steps
Backup First: Always read the radio's current "codeplug" and save it as a backup before making any changes.
Read Radio: Connect the cable to the microphone port, power on the radio, and select "Read" in the CPS software. Configure Channels: Enter your TX/RX frequencies. Set the CTCSS/DPL codes for squelch.
Adjust Channel Spacing (12.5 kHz for narrow, 25 kHz for wide).
Write to Radio: Once finished, use the "Write" command to push the new settings to the Go to product viewer dialog for this item.
💡 Pro Tip: If you get a communication error, ensure you have selected the correct COM Port in the software's settings (Help > About CPS can help verify version details).

The Motorola GM338 is a versatile mobile radio known for its high channel capacity and customization through proprietary Customer Programming Software (CPS). While "repack" versions are often sought after for convenience, they frequently originate from unofficial sources, which introduces significant security and legal risks. Purpose and Functionality Benefits of Using Motorola GM338 Programming Software Using
The core purpose of the Motorola GM338 programming software is to act as an interface between a computer and the radio hardware.
Customization: Users can program up to 128 channels, setting individual power outputs and privacy codes like Private Line (PL) or Digital Private Line (DPL).
Feature Management: The software enables one-touch access for customizable buttons and configures audio quality through voice compression technology.
System Maintenance: It allows for reading radio data (serial numbers, model types), writing new configurations, and updating firmware. Risks of Unofficial "Repacks"
The term "repack" typically refers to unofficial software packages that have been modified or bundled for easier installation outside of official channels.
Security Vulnerabilities: Using third-party installers can expose systems to DLL hijacking, where local attackers escalate privileges by replacing legitimate files with malicious ones.
Copyright and Legal Issues: Motorola holds exclusive rights to its computer programs. Reproducing or distributing this software without express written permission is a violation of copyright law.
System Instability: Unofficial versions may not be compatible with newer Windows versions or specific hardware interfaces, leading to failed programming attempts or "bricked" radios. Safe Acquisition and Resources

The search for an "exclusive download repack" of Motorola GM338 programming software primarily leads to unauthorized or potentially unsafe third-party sources. Authentic Motorola Customer Programming Software (CPS) is proprietary and typically requires a licensed account for legal access. Critical Review: "Exclusive Repack" Risks
Searching for "repacks" or "exclusive downloads" for radio software often uncovers files that are modified or distributed outside of official channels.
Security Concerns: Repacked software from "dubious sites" often carries a high risk of malware or viruses. Since these files are not signed by Motorola, they could compromise your computer or the radio itself.
Legal & Copyright Issues: Motorola holds strict copyrights on its computer programs. Using or distributing unauthorized copies (pirated software) is a violation of their licensing agreements and can lead to legal complications.
Functional Risks: Using an incorrect or modified version of CPS can result in "EEPROM HW/CS Error" messages, effectively "bricking" the radio and making it unusable without professional repair. Legitimate Alternatives for GM338 Programming
If you need to program a Motorola GM338 (part of the GP340/GM340 series), consider these safer routes:
Official Dealer: The most reliable method is to visit a local Motorola dealer. They have the licensed software and specialized cables to program frequencies safely for a small fee.
Authorized CPS Download: Access the official Motorola Solutions Support portal. While some modern CPS versions (like MOTOTRBO 2.0) are free to download, older Professional Series software often requires a purchased license.
Physical Media: You can sometimes purchase the legitimate Motorola ENLN4115 software from authorized radio equipment retailers.

Why Use the Motorola GM338 Programming Software?
The GM338 is part of Motorola’s Professional Series. Unlike consumer radios, it doesn't allow for "front-panel programming" of its core features. The CPS software allows you to:
Manage Channels: Program up to 128 channels with specific RX/TX frequencies.
Signaling: Configure MDC1200, Quik-Call II, and DTMF signaling. Exclusive Download Repack We are pleased to offer
Power Settings: Adjust high/low power settings to preserve equipment life or extend range.
Custom Buttons: Map the P1–P4 buttons to functions like Scan, Repeater Talkaround, or Emergency Alert. The "Repack" Advantage

Before downloading the software, ensure you have the necessary hardware to bridge the gap between your PC and the radio:
Programming Cable: The GM338 uses a standard RJ45-to-DB9 or RJ45-to-USB cable that plugs into the microphone port on the front of the radio.
PC Connection: If using a DB9 cable, you may need a high-quality USB-to-RS232 adapter (using the Prolific or FTDI chipset).
Power Supply: Always ensure the radio is connected to a stable 13.8V DC power source during programming. A power loss during the "Write" process can brick the radio. How to Install and Use the GM338 CPS 1. Download and Extract
Once you have secured your exclusive download repack, extract the ZIP or RAR folder to your desktop. Ensure you run the setup.exe as an Administrator. 2. Install Drivers
If your repack includes a "Drivers" folder, install these first. This ensures that when you plug in your USB programming cable, the PC assigns it a COM Port (e.g., COM3). You can verify this in the Windows Device Manager. 3. Read the Radio Connect the cable to the radio and the PC. Turn the radio on. Open the CPS software. Go to File > Read Device.
Tip: Always save a backup of the original codeplug (the radio’s data file) before making any changes. 4. Edit and Write
Modify your frequencies in the "Conventional Personality" section. Once finished, click the Write Device icon. Do not touch the cable or the power switch until the progress bar reaches 100% and the radio reboots. Troubleshooting Common Errors
"Couldn't open port": Check your COM port settings in the software (Setup > Communication). Ensure it matches the port assigned in Device Manager.
"Incompatible Radio Model": The GM338 software is region-specific (AZ for Asia, LA for Latin America, AA for North America). Ensure your repack supports your specific model suffix.
Communication Error: This is often caused by a low-quality "clone" cable. If the software fails to read, try a cable with a genuine FTDI chip.

To program the Motorola GM338 , you need the specific Customer Programming Software (CPS) designed for the Waris/Professional series. Official downloads for Motorola software are generally hosted on the Motorola Solutions Support Portal. Essential Software Details
Software Name: Professional Radio CPS (Customer Programming Software).
Version History: Versions such as R06.12.05 are common for these legacy models.
Compatibility: This radio is an analog model. Be careful not to confuse its software with the newer MOTOTRBO CPS (used for digital radios like the XPR series) or the GP329/GM339 specific software, which is not compatible with the
OS Requirements: Older versions often perform best on legacy Windows systems, though some users report success on Windows 7 through Windows 11 with administrative rights. Programming Setup
